#ifndef _CISO_BLOB_H
#define _CISO_BLOB_H

#include "Blob.h"
#include "FileUtil.h"

#define CISO_MAGIC     "CISO"
#define CISO_HEAD_SIZE (0x8000)
#define CISO_MAP_SIZE  (CISO_HEAD_SIZE - 8)

namespace DiscIO
{

bool IsCISOBlob(const char* filename);

// Blocks that won't compress to less than 97% of the original size are stored as-is.
struct CISO_Head_t
{
	u8  magic[4];            // "CISO"
	u32 block_size;          // stored as litte endian (not network byte order)
	u8  map[CISO_MAP_SIZE];  // 0=unused, 1=used, others=invalid
};

typedef u16 CISO_Map_t;

const CISO_Map_t CISO_UNUSED_BLOCK = (CISO_Map_t)~0;

class CISOFileReader : public IBlobReader
{
	File::IOFile m_file;
	CISOFileReader(std::FILE* file);
	s64 m_size;

public:
	static CISOFileReader* Create(const char* filename);

	u64 GetDataSize() const { return m_size; }
	u64 GetRawSize() const { return m_size; }
	bool Read(u64 offset, u64 nbytes, u8* out_ptr);

private:
	CISO_Head_t header;
	CISO_Map_t ciso_map[CISO_MAP_SIZE];
};

}  // namespace

#endif  // _FILE_BLOB_H
